Heart disease remains one of the leading causes of death worldwide, yet many people still believe heart attacks happen suddenly and without warning. In reality, medical experts say the body often sends signals days—or even weeks—before a serious cardiac event occurs.
Recognizing these early warning signs can be life-saving. According to health professionals, paying attention to subtle changes in your body could give you the chance to seek treatment before it’s too late.
Below are seven key symptoms that may indicate your heart is under stress.
Feeling tired after a long day is normal. However, unexplained and persistent fatigue—especially when it interferes with daily activities—can be a warning sign of heart trouble.
Experts note that this type of fatigue often occurs because the heart is struggling to pump blood efficiently, forcing the body to work harder. Many patients, particularly women, report extreme tiredness weeks before a heart attack.
Chest pain is the most commonly recognized symptom of a heart attack, but it doesn’t always feel dramatic. It may appear as mild pressure, tightness, or discomfort that comes and goes.
The sensation can last for several minutes or disappear and return later. In some cases, it may spread to other parts of the body, including the arms, neck, or jaw.
Ignoring these early warning signs can be dangerous, especially if they become more frequent over time.
Difficulty breathing without a clear reason—such as physical exertion—may signal that your heart isn’t pumping effectively.
Shortness of breath can occur on its own or alongside chest discomfort. It may feel like you can’t catch your breath or are suddenly winded during simple activities.
This symptom is particularly important to note if it appears suddenly or worsens over time.
Occasional dizziness can be caused by dehydration or low blood sugar. However, frequent or unexplained lightheadedness may indicate reduced blood flow to the brain.
Some individuals describe feeling as though they might faint or that the room is spinning. When combined with other symptoms like chest pain or shortness of breath, it could point to a serious cardiac issue.
Many people do not associate stomach discomfort with heart problems. However, nausea, indigestion, or abdominal pain can sometimes be early signs of a heart attack.
These symptoms may be mistaken for digestive issues such as acid reflux or food poisoning. Medical experts warn that this confusion can delay treatment, increasing the risk of complications.
Breaking out in a cold sweat without physical activity or heat exposure can be a red flag. This type of sweating is often linked to the body’s “fight or flight” response when under stress.
If you notice sudden, unexplained sweating—especially alongside other symptoms—it may indicate your body is reacting to a cardiovascular problem.
Swelling in the lower extremities can occur when the heart is unable to pump blood efficiently. This causes fluid to build up in the body, particularly in the legs and feet.
While swelling can have multiple causes, persistent or worsening edema should not be ignored, as it may signal heart failure or other serious conditions.
One of the biggest dangers of heart disease is that symptoms are often subtle and easy to dismiss. Many people attribute fatigue to stress, nausea to diet, or dizziness to lack of sleep.
However, doctors emphasize that recognizing patterns—especially when multiple symptoms occur together—can make a critical difference. Early intervention can significantly reduce damage to the heart and improve survival rates.
If you experience any combination of these symptoms, especially if they are new or worsening, it is essential to seek medical attention immediately.
